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47148 08 6485 2883765
297162 876578 4379254440
297162 876578 4379254440
36031 223753241 628 4141993 98
All about undefined
Interested in learning more?
297162 876578 4379254440
36031 223753241 628 4141993 98
See more
153515209 453 098410
69853 1355052 3323
See more
653839 899 182463
0455462908 29224474 813 463131
See more